    XTO Energy Inc. is an American energy company and subsidiary of ExxonMobil principally operating in North America. Acquired by ExxonMobil in 2010 and based out of Spring, Texas , it is involved with the production, processing, transportation, and development of oil and natural gas resources.

  5. Dec 14, 2009 · Exxon Mobil Corporation and XTO Energy Inc. announced an all-stock transaction valued at $41 billion in December 2009. The agreement enhanced ExxonMobil's position in unconventional natural gas and oil resources and created a new upstream organization in Fort Worth, Texas.

    XTO Energy Inc., a subsidiary of Exxon Mobil Corporation, is a leading natural gas and oil producer in the U.S. with expertise in developing tight gas, shale gas and unconventional oil resources.
